Hi,I wonder, are there any way to install support for "better" graphic cards on WS?As an example; If I want to use an ASUS 210 Silent 1GB DD3. It works automagically when starting up the ws, but the built in linux driver is not using the extra resources on it. What I want to to is enabling the use of at least Openshot, but preferably even kdenlive (I dont think it has more demands on hardware then openshot). Doing this on our WS now is impossible, due to flickering when running preflight view in the program. That is, if you record a movie with a Iphone, or videodevice, add it to openshot and then watch it from there it is not running smoothly. I tried to run it from a local disk (to see if it was a network issue) on the ws, but it did not work better. It seems to be a graphic issue. If Nvidia is hard to support, what about ATI? Any suggestions?
You can pull in Xorg from squeeze-backports. That gives you OpenGL and other features on current hardware. Works for Intel based chipsets and Nvidia chipsets. We have not tested ATI boards, as we do not have machines deployed with that chipset...
